### Flaky Integration Tests — Paylode Service

The Paylode integration suite has three known flaky tests around settlement retries; rerun once before escalating. If a release is blocked only by these, the on-call may approve an override, but the artifact still needs a valid signature before the deployer accepts it. Overrides are logged automatically. Sign the release artifact with the key below.

deploy key for kajof-fajop: bky6_gDHw9Q

## Deployment — Keyhaven Reset Flow v2

This release replaces the legacy password reset flow with token-based links and a shorter expiry window. Deploy the `reset-service` before the web tier; old reset links remain valid for 24 hours after cut-over, then the compatibility shim can be disabled. Run the smoke suite against the staging mailer first — the new templates will bounce if the sender profile is missing. Rollback is a single toggle plus a redeploy of the web tier. The service reads its runtime configuration from the values below.

service settings:
WENATH_LOG_LEVEL=debug
WENATH_METRICS_HOST=metrics.wenath.norvalabs.internal
WENATH_POOL_SIZE=16

14:22 — Offline sync regression confirmed (Terrapath field-survey app)

At 14:22 the on-call engineer reproduced the data-loss path: surveys saved while offline were marked synced once connectivity returned, even when the upload was rejected. The queue flush skipped the server acknowledgement check introduced in the previous sprint. Release manager note: the fix must ship before the coastal survey season. The offending build is identified by the token recorded below.

session token of kawif-fawig = htk31_f3f599be2b1a34affb1efa8d0feccf8